Israel's Netanyahu ousted as 'change' coalition forms new government

Description

A motley alliance of Israeli parties on Sunday ousted Benjamin Netanyahu, the country's longest-serving prime minister, and formed a new government in a seismic shift in the country's turbulent politics. ABC New's Jordana Miller says.
